Knowing a router’s default credentials pose an immediate security risk, the section outlines a systematic approach to changing them and reinforcing overall network protection.
Users should replace default passwords with unique, strong credentials, enable MFA if available, and document changes.

Following the security improvements from changing default credentials, the next step is to configure the wireless environment: establishing SSIDs, selecting robust passwords, and setting up guest networks.
Set up SSIDs, customize passwords, and guest networks with Secure settings; firmware updates, and parental controls ensure ongoing protection.
Implement distinct SSIDs for guests, enable WPA3 where possible, monitor activity, and document changes precisely.
Optimizing router performance hinges on a structured approach that balances speed, reliability, and safety. The process begins with baseline measurements, then selective configuration changes: channel optimization, QoS rules for critical devices, and firewall tightness. Ongoing security auditing verifies access controls, while firmware rollback options remain ready to reverse unstable updates, preserving stability without sacrificing protection or speed. Regular documentation completes the cycle.

Wi Fi drop causes include interference, signal attenuation, and router overload; device disconnection factors involve power-saving settings and mismatched security.
